ACO Assignment Improvement Act of 2025 This bill establishes additional requirements for assigning Medicare fee-for-service beneficiaries to accountable care organizations (ACOs) under the Medicare shared savings program. Under current law, the program enables ACOs to receive payments for savings stemming from care coordination and management. The bill requires the basis for assignment to reflect beneficiaries' utilization of not only primary care services provided by ACO physicians, but also those provided by other ACO practitioners—specifically, physician assistants, nurse practitioners, and clinical nurse specialists.

Who sponsored HR.4773?
HR.4773 was sponsored by Adrian Smith (R-Nebraska).

R. 4773 IN TH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ES July 25, 2025 Mr. Smith of Nebraska (for himself and Ms. DelBene ) introduced the following bill; which was referred to the Committee on Ways and Means , and in addition to the Committee on Energy and Commerce , for a period to be subsequently determined by the Speaker, in each case for consideration of such provisions as fall within the jurisdiction of the committee concerned A BILL To amend title XVIII of the Social Security Act to establish a SNF-at-home program under the Medicare program. 1. Short title This Act may be cited as the ACO Assignment Improvement Act of 2025 . 2. Improvements to the assignment of beneficiaries under the medicare shared savings program Section 1899(c)(1) of the Social Security Act ( 42 U.S.C. 1395jjj(c)(1) ) is amended— (1) in subparagraph (A), by striking and at the end; (2) in subparagraph (B), by striking the period at the end and inserting ; and ; and (3) by adding at the end the following new subparagraph: (C) in the case of performance years beginning on or after January 1, 2027, primary care services provided under this title by an ACO professional described in subsection (h)(1)(B) .
